Everything Everywhere All At Once [2022] An aging Chinese immigrant is swept up in an insane adventure, where she alone can save the world by exploring other universes connecting with the lives she could have led. One of the strangest most intense action packed movies of recent times, highly inventive and original with a full range of emotions.

The Thief, His Wife and the Canoe [2022 TV Limited Series] Four-part UK TV drama based on the true story and book of how prison officer John Darwin faked his own death in a canoe accident to claim life insurance and avoid bankruptcy - unbeknownst to his two sons. Simple to follow well-made crime drama from the point of view of his coercive controlled wife and partner in crime.

  4. Jimmy Savile: A British Horror Story [2022 TV Limited Series] UK entertainer Savile had charmed a nation with his eccentricity and philanthropy in some eyes. But sexual abuse allegations exposed a shocking unseen side of his persona. A bleak two part three hour documentary doesn't really say much that hasn't already been told, but just emphasizes it in haunting style for a global audience.
